Abstract

Based on the observations by the researcher during being a lecture in S1 degree[G1]  of PGSD in education UNESA, the level students’ participation at the time of lecturing is not as expected. In the previous research, the lecturing activities which have done until mid-semester, the researcher observed 31 students, only a small percentage of students actively participated in the way of asking questions, answering questions, also conveying an idea. In the previous result [G2] [G3] showed that the level of students’ participation in the course less than 35%. Whereas, the researcher expects every student should more actively to contribute either assessment of course participation which has 2 points, equal with mid-term test point (UTS). At least, the target of the researcher is 50% or more than students' participation actively. So, classroom action research is needed. In this research, the observer [G4] applied jigsaw learning model as the basic concept [G5] ofPPKn course particularly. Jigsaw learning model was chosen because the steps used were known be able involve all students as the result that in the course every students will be prosecuted as skilled team activities and work well together independently as well as group to understand the concept or material which being learning, therefore it can move the students [G6] [G7] to participate in the way of asking questions, answering questions, also conveying idea.[G8] [G9] [G10] This research used two cycles which include four steps i.e. planning, action, observation, and reflection. The result of observation and reflection in every cycle, it can conclude the first cycle was successful with the participate rate 64,5% out of 31 students who attend in lecturing. The second cycle was successful reached 73,3% out of 30 students in lecturing. In the research cycle 1 and cycle 2 were reliable. Therefore, cooperative learning model in jigsaw type can improve students’ participation in lecturing.
